Galician Directions

These are expressions used when giving or getting directions in Galician. Very useful when trying to find your way around or when lost.

Excuse me! (to ask someone): perdoe (polite) / perdoa (informal)
Can you show me?: pode mostrame? (polite) / podes mostrarme? (informal)
I'm lost: estou perdido
I'm not from here: non son de aquí
Can I help you?: podo axudarte? (informal) / podo axudarlle? (polite)
Can you help me?: podes axudarme?(informal) / pode xudarme?(polite)
It's near here: está preto de aquí
It's far from here: está lonxe de aquí
Go straight: segue (informal) / siga(polite) todo recto
Turn left: xira (informal) / xire (polite) á esquerda
Turn right: xira (informal) / xire (polite) á dereita
One moment please!: un momento por favor!
Come with me!: ven (informal) / veña (polite)comigo
How can I get to the museum? : cómo podo chegar ata o museo?
How long does it take to get there?: canto se tarda en chegar alí?
Downtown (city center): centro da cidade

The following are words which might be used alone or in combination with other words to ask or give directions.

Near: preto
Far: lonxe
Right: dereita
Left: esquerda
Straight: recto
There: alí
Here: aquí
To walk: camiñar
To drive: conducir
To turn: xirar
Traffic light: semáforo
